Edmonton lies at 54°N. At this latitude, day length varies significantly through the year — from roughly 7–8 hours in midwinter to 16–17 hours at midsummer.
Sunset shifts later through spring and earlier through autumn — changing fastest near the equinoxes and slowest near the summer and winter solstices. See the year chart to visualise how sunset times shift month by month for Edmonton.
The longest day in Edmonton is around 17h 3m (around June 21). The shortest is around 7h 28m (around December 21). Days are currently getting longer — gaining about 1 minute per day.
